Key Insights

The global 110 Methyl Vinyl Silicone Rubber (MVQ) market is experiencing robust growth, driven by increasing demand across diverse sectors. While precise market size figures are not provided, considering typical CAGR rates for specialty chemicals (let's assume a conservative 5% CAGR for illustrative purposes), a reasonable estimation places the 2025 market value at approximately $500 million. This growth is fueled primarily by the expanding aviation and electronics industries, which rely heavily on MVQ's unique properties of high temperature resistance, flexibility, and dielectric strength. The automotive and chemical processing sectors also contribute significantly to market demand. The market is segmented by type (methyl-capped and vinyl-capped) and application (aviation, electronics, mechanical, chemical, and others). Methyl-capped MVQ currently dominates due to its superior performance characteristics in certain applications, but vinyl-capped variants are gaining traction owing to cost-effectiveness in specific niches. Emerging trends indicate a growing preference for sustainable and eco-friendly manufacturing processes within the MVQ supply chain, putting pressure on manufacturers to adopt more responsible practices. Geopolitically, Asia-Pacific, particularly China, is currently the largest regional market, driven by rapid industrialization and substantial manufacturing capabilities. However, North America and Europe continue to hold significant market shares, largely influenced by strong demand from aerospace and electronics companies. Restraints to market growth include fluctuating raw material prices (like silicone and other chemicals) and the potential for emerging alternative materials that may compete with MVQ in specific applications.

Driving Forces: What's Propelling the 110 Methyl Vinyl Silicone Rubber Market?

Several key factors are driving the expansion of the 110 methyl vinyl silicone rubber market. The rising demand for high-performance materials in diverse applications such as aerospace, electronics, and automotive industries is a significant driver. The inherent properties of 110 methyl vinyl silicone rubber, including its excellent heat resistance, electrical insulation, and chemical inertness, make it indispensable in these sectors. The growing adoption of advanced technologies and the miniaturization of electronic devices further enhance the demand for this material, particularly in applications requiring precise sealing and insulation. Furthermore, the increasing focus on safety and reliability in various industries, including medical devices and healthcare, is driving the adoption of high-quality, durable materials like 110 methyl vinyl silicone rubber. Government regulations and standards related to material safety and performance also play a crucial role, encouraging manufacturers to utilize materials with superior properties. The continuous advancements in silicone rubber technology, focusing on improved performance characteristics and enhanced processing capabilities, are further contributing to the market growth. Finally, the expansion of emerging economies, particularly in Asia, is creating new opportunities for the production and consumption of 110 methyl vinyl silicone rubber.

Challenges and Restraints in 110 Methyl Vinyl Silicone Rubber Market

Despite the significant growth potential, the 110 methyl vinyl silicone rubber market faces several challenges. Fluctuations in the prices of raw materials, such as silicone monomers and other chemical additives, can significantly impact the overall production costs and profitability of manufacturers. Competition from alternative materials, such as other types of elastomers and plastics, can also constrain market growth. Technological advancements in competing materials may lead to the substitution of 110 methyl vinyl silicone rubber in certain applications. Meeting stringent environmental regulations and ensuring sustainable manufacturing processes present further challenges. The complexity of the manufacturing process and the need for specialized equipment and expertise can also limit entry into the market for new players. Furthermore, economic downturns and fluctuations in global demand can impact the growth trajectory of the market. The reliance on a relatively small number of key raw material suppliers also poses a risk to supply chain stability and can lead to price volatility. Managing these challenges effectively is crucial for ensuring the sustained growth of the 110 methyl vinyl silicone rubber market.

Key Region or Country & Segment to Dominate the Market

The Asia-Pacific region, particularly China, is expected to dominate the 110 methyl vinyl silicone rubber market throughout the forecast period (2025-2033). This dominance stems from several factors:

  • Rapid Industrialization: The region's rapid industrialization fuels the demand across various sectors, including electronics, automotive, and construction.

  • Growing Manufacturing Base: A large and expanding manufacturing base necessitates substantial quantities of high-performance materials like 110 methyl vinyl silicone rubber.

  • Cost Advantages: Lower manufacturing costs in some parts of the region offer a competitive edge.

  • Government Support: Government initiatives promoting technological advancement and industrial development contribute to the growth.

  • Increased Domestic Consumption: Rising disposable incomes and technological advancements are driving consumption within the region.

In terms of segments, the methyl-capped variety is expected to hold a larger market share due to its superior properties compared to vinyl-capped variants. The electronics application segment is projected to experience the fastest growth, driven by the increasing demand for high-performance sealing and insulation materials in electronic devices. While the aviation and automotive sectors are also significant consumers, the pervasive use of 110 methyl vinyl silicone rubber in numerous electronic components, ranging from smartphones to large-scale industrial equipment, positions this application segment as a key driver of market expansion. The ongoing trend towards miniaturization and increased functionality in electronics further fuels this segment's dominance.
